Best herbicides for black nightshade in sorghum

For black nightshade in sorghum, the weed guides list 12 active-ingredient groups rated good or excellent, after checking that the products are labeled for sorghum.

Black Nightshade control in sorghum

Every listed product is labeled for sorghum. Ratings are shown when each weed guide that rates this weed stays at good or excellent for the active-ingredient group. If a guide gives a range, the weaker end of the range has to be good or excellent.

Based on 1 weed guide, 12 active-ingredient groups are rated good or excellent for black nightshade in sorghum.
